What is a microgrid (MG)?
Within the smart grid (SG) paradigm, the microgrid (MG) concept has been pointed out as a pathway for the implementation of future smart distribution networks since it extends and decentralizes the distribution network monitoring and control capability and provides key self-healing capabilities to low voltage (LV) networks.

Could a microgrid be a virtual power plant?
Jorge Elizondo, a microgrid engineer and co-founder of Heila Technologies, said that with a controller in each location, energy-sharing becomes more feasible, as does the possibility for an entire neighborhood to serve as an aggregated reserve of power for the main grid: a virtual power plant.

Is PV generation a good option for microgrids?
As highlighted by Bacha et al. in , PV generation in particular has the higher potential for an increasing number of application in microgrids, as it is the most distributed means of electricity production from a geographical point of view.
